Bernard Jensen Products, Solana Beach, California, 1970. Reprint. Hardcover. Very Good Condition/Good. Illustrator: Photographic and Illustrations. XIV, 278 pages, last page blank, introduction by Napoleon Hill, preface by author. Black-and-white photographic frontispiece, of author. The text is illustrated with the occasional black-and-white photograph and numerous black-and-white line drawings throughout the text. Dark blue coloured textured boards with gilt embossed titles to the front panel and backstrip. Rubbing to the book corners and light browning to the text block edges. Plain text dustwrapper with light blue and white coloured background with darker blue and pink titles to the front panel and blue titles to the backstrip. Chipping to the dustwrapper corners and backstrip edges. There is a 1.25 " tear to the lower right-hand corner of the rear dustwrapper panel, a 2 inch tear along the lower rear fold over creases and a few small tears to the top dustwrapper edge. Creasing to the dustwrapper edges and rubbing to the dustwrapper panels. Browning and handling marks to the dustwrapper panels. In this book the author presents his formula for long life, rejuvenation and health -- the natural way. This book was first published in 1946. Size: 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all.
